OXYGEN-GO by DEWETRON enables seamless connectivity from a mobile device to OXYGEN running on the DAQ system via SCPI. Users can preview analog hardware channel data, review and modify hardware channel settings, and remotely start, stop, or pause recordings. This functionality supports test and measurement engineers during instrumentation and sensor checks—both before and after measurements—especially when the DUT and testbed control are located separately.
Prerequisites:
- OXYGEN's SCPI interface must be enabled
- DAQ system and mobile device must be connected to the same network
